What the Research Says

The U.S. Department of Energy estimates that homeowners can save up to 10 percent annually on heating and cooling costs simply by using a programmable thermostat to adjust temperatures during periods when they are asleep or away from home. Smart thermostats take this concept much further by learning your daily habits and making automated adjustments that traditional programmable thermostats simply cannot match. Industry studies consistently show that smart thermostats save users between 10 and 23 percent on heating costs and between 15 and 30 percent on cooling costs, depending on climate zone, home size, insulation quality, and individual usage patterns.
How Smart Thermostats Save Energy
Smart thermostats employ several strategies to reduce energy consumption. The most impactful is automated setback scheduling, where the thermostat intelligently raises or lowers the temperature when you are asleep or away from home. Advanced models use geofencing technology that detects when your phone leaves the home area and adjusts the temperature accordingly, ensuring you are never heating or cooling an empty house even if your schedule varies day to day.
Another powerful feature is weather adaptation. Modern smart thermostats connect to local weather forecasts and adjust their strategies based on upcoming conditions. For example, if a heatwave is forecasted for the afternoon, the thermostat might pre-cool your home during the morning off-peak hours when energy rates are lower, then allow the temperature to rise gradually during peak hours. This technique, known as precooling or preheating, can significantly reduce peak electricity demand and associated costs.
Real-World Savings Examples
A typical household in the northeastern United States spending $2,500 annually on heating and cooling might save between $250 and $500 per year with a smart thermostat. In warmer climates where air conditioning dominates, such as the southwestern U.S., savings can be even higher proportionally. Many homeowners report recouping the cost of their smart thermostat within one to two heating or cooling seasons. Additionally, many utility companies offer rebates for installing smart thermostats, ranging from $25 to $100 per device, which effectively lowers the upfront cost.
Maximizing Your Savings
To get the most out of your smart thermostat, start by carefully setting your schedule. Most savings come from periods when you are asleep or away, so ensure your thermostat is programmed for these times. Enable geofencing if your device supports it, and take full advantage of the energy reports to understand your usage patterns and identify opportunities for improvement. Finally, consider combining your smart thermostat with other energy-saving measures such as LED lighting, smart plugs, and proper insulation to achieve compounded savings throughout your entire home.
Is It Worth the Investment in 2026?
For the vast majority of homeowners, the answer is a clear yes. With smart thermostat prices ranging from $60 for budget models to approximately $250 for premium units, and annual savings typically falling between $150 and $300, the payback period is usually less than two years.
